Indianapolis is a big city with a small-town feel, one that was founded as a manufacturing and transportation hub in 1821. It grew to be the second-largest railroad center in the nation and home to 60 automakers, giving Detroit a run for its money in the car industry. And what of the job market there today? The city has a low unemployment rate of 4.2% and thrives in industries outside of the transportation sector. More than 90 national companies across industries have headquarters in the city.
